Description
Ehrlichia Canis, Leishmania Canis, Anaplasma Canis and Babesia gibberii are the four pathogens that cause blood-related diseases, and although they have their own characteristics, they also have some common features.
Similarities
Transmission route:
Both are transmitted by vectors: Ehrlichia Canis, Anaplasma Canis and Babesia gibberii are transmitted by ticks, and Leishmaniasis Canis is transmitted by sandflies (sandflies).
Symptoms:
They can all cause systemic symptoms such as fever, drowsiness, and weight loss.
Can cause anemia and enlarged lymph nodes.
Geographical distribution:
It is distributed globally and is more common especially in media-active regions.
Differences
Specific symptoms:
Ehrlichia Canis: Nose bleeding, bleeding tendency, joint pain, and eye problems (such as uveitis).
Leishmania Canis: skin ulcers, depilation, skin thickening, weight loss, nose bleeding and kidney failure.
Canine Anaplasma: acute anemia, jaundice, spleen enlargement.
Babesia gibsoni Canis: severe anemia, jaundice, fever and renal insufficiency.
